Core Viewpoint - Paddleboarding has become a popular summer activity in Beijing, but safety concerns have arisen due to unregulated practices in open water areas [1] Group 1: Safety Guidelines - The Beijing Xicheng District Fire Rescue Team and Shichahai Water Sports Center organized a safety awareness event to educate citizens on paddleboarding safety [1] - Paddleboarding requires specific water conditions: water flow should be less than 0.5 meters per second, water quality should be between Class II and Class III, and the water depth should ideally be between 1.5 to 3 meters [1] - Participants must wear life jackets and choose locations with professional rescue support, as the Shichahai Water Sports Center has lifeguards and patrol boats for emergency situations [1] Group 2: Recommendations for Participants - Participants should prepare adequately by bringing quick-dry clothing, sunscreen, and a change of clothes, and children under 7 should be accompanied by an adult [2] - Newcomers are advised to avoid attempting difficult maneuvers and should start with a kneeling position to enhance stability [2] - Pre-boarding checks are essential, including verifying paddleboard pressure between 15 to 18 pascals and ensuring the foot leash is intact [2] Group 3: Warnings Against Unsafe Practices - The Xicheng District Fire Rescue Station warns against paddleboarding in wild water areas due to unpredictable conditions such as underwater obstacles and sudden weather changes [3] - It is recommended to use regulated venues like swimming pools or water parks and to always wear a life jacket with a crotch strap [3] - Non-swimmers should only participate under the supervision of a qualified instructor to ensure safety [3]
